Ricketts Glen Overview

Ricketts Glen State Park is one of Pennsylvania’s natural gems, covering over 13,000 acres across Columbia, Luzerne, and Sullivan counties. Established in the mid-20th century, this park is renowned for its natural beauty, vibrant landscapes, and impressive waterfalls. The park is home to the Glens Natural Area, a National Natural Landmark which showcases a spectacular series of 22 named waterfalls. Among these, Ganoga Falls stands out as the highest waterfall at an impressive 94 feet.

The diverse terrain of Ricketts Glen offers visitors a range of outdoor activities year-round. With its lush old-growth forests, scenic vistas, and picturesque water features, the park is a popular destination for hiking, camping, and other outdoor recreational activities. Whether you’re an experienced hiker looking to conquer the Falls Trail or a family seeking a peaceful picnic spot by the water, Ricketts Glen has something for everyone.

This park is not just a hiking destination; it features various ecosystems, providing a habitat for an extensive array of plant and animal species. In addition, the park offers activities such as boating, fishing, and horseback riding, making it a well-rounded location for outdoor enthusiasts.

How to Plan a Visit To Ricketts Glen

Planning a visit to Ricketts Glen State Park can be an exciting experience, and a little preparation can help you maximize your time there. Here are some steps to consider when you decide to explore this lovely park.

First, check the weather conditions before your visit. Pennsylvania’s weather can be unpredictable, so knowing what to expect can help you dress accordingly. Dress in layers, wear comfortable hiking shoes, and bring rain gear if there’s a forecast for rain.

Next, whether you are planning a day trip or an extended stay, take some time to research your options. If you’re looking to hike, consider the Falls Trail, which is a 7.2-mile loop known for its breathtaking scenery. Make sure to arrive early in the day to ensure you have enough time to complete the hike.

For those who want to stay overnight, Ricketts Glen offers several options for camping. Make reservations in advance, especially during peak seasons, as campsites tend to fill quickly. Preparation is key; make sure to bring enough food and water, as well as any camping equipment necessary for a comfortable stay.

When visiting, don’t forget about safety. Always stick to marked paths and be cautious near water. If you’re hiking with children, keep an eye on them to ensure they stay safe near cliffs or slippery areas. Pack a first aid kit just in case.

Things to Do In Ricketts Glen

Ricketts Glen State Park is a treasure trove of activities for visitors of all ages. Here’s a rundown of things to do when you visit this beautiful destination.

One of the main attractions is hiking the Falls Trail. This trail leads you directly to the series of waterfalls, providing stunning views along the way. The path offers a mix of rugged terrain and well-maintained trails, making it suitable for both beginners and seasoned hikers. The journey is dotted with scenic overlooks, allowing ample opportunities to take in the breathtaking surroundings.

Besides hiking, camping is one of the park’s significant attractions. With numerous campsites available, visitors can immerse themselves in nature overnight. From standard campsites to more luxurious deluxe cottages, accommodations cater to various preferences. You can enjoy roasting marshmallows by the campfire while listening to the sounds of the forest around you.

Fishing and boating are also popular activities in the park’s lakes and streams. Pack your fishing rod and try your luck at catching trout or other fish in the clear waters. Boating is permitted in designated areas, offering a unique perspective of Ricketts Glen from the water.

For those interested in horseback riding, there are designated trails within the park where you can enjoy a peaceful ride through beautiful scenery. This is a great way to explore the area while experiencing the beauty of nature up close.

Don’t forget about picnic areas within the park. Bring along a blanket and some snacks to enjoy after a long day of hiking or exploring. It’s the perfect way to relax and recharge while surrounded by lush greenery.

In winter, Ricketts Glen transforms into a snowy wonderland perfect for snowmobiling. The park offers designated snowmobiling trails, making it an enjoyable destination for those who love winter sports.

Amenities and Facilities in Ricketts Glen

Ricketts Glen State Park is well-equipped with various amenities to ensure visitors have a comfortable experience. Facilities are thoughtfully arranged to cater to different needs and enhance your visit.

The park provides restrooms and shower facilities for campers and day visitors alike. It is vital to have access to clean facilities, especially after a long day outdoors. These amenities ensure that you’ll feel refreshed and ready to enjoy more activities in the park.

Additionally, the park features picnic areas with tables and grills, perfect for families or groups looking to enjoy meals in a natural setting. Come prepared with your food, and take the opportunity to socialize over a delicious picnic.

A food concession/store is also available within the park. If you forget to pack essentials or want to grab a quick snack, you can find what you need without having to leave the park. This convenience means you can spend more time enjoying the stunning scenery.

Ricketts Glen is designed to be accessible for everyone, with several handicap-accessible facilities. This accessibility enables all visitors, regardless of their physical abilities, to enjoy the beauty of the park.

The park also offers educational programs throughout the year, which allows visitors to learn more about the local ecology and the importance of conservation. These programs are informative and help foster a deeper appreciation for the natural world.

Ricketts Glen Location & How To Get There

Ricketts Glen State Park is located at 695 State Route 487, Benton, PA 17814. It is easily accessible by road and is a perfect getaway for both locals and tourists. For those using GPS navigation, the coordinates are approximately 41.33517 latitude and -76.30153 longitude.
